Day 1

First day was mostly just a check in and meet and greet as people arrived at different times. 8 of us drove, while we had one person fly in and get picked up at the airport. Once everyone had arrived and some pizza had been consumed, IamBatman opened a bottle of champagne Tornado provided to toast the first ever C3G Con!

https://www.mediafire.com/convkey/88...m8c070ul6g.jpg

Then IamBatman hosted the first event of the Con that night. It was a Royal Rumble in which all 9 of us participated at once, controlling just one figure each.

https://www.mediafire.com/convkey/3b...i564xpql6g.jpg

After each figure was taken out, they received a new figure that dropped on the board, until no figures were left. There were 27 figures in total used, with each new figure to enter the fray being a bit tougher than the last.

https://www.mediafire.com/convkey/07...9oml019g6g.jpg

Soundwarp's brother won the event, after also having his first figure also be the one to last the longest out of the starting 9. Superman was the last figure to arrive to the fight, and also was the last figure left standing.
